The term "case material" is correct and commonly used in written English.
It refers to the evidence or examples that support a particular argument or claim in a sentence. It can also be used to describe the specific details or information related to a particular legal or medical case. Example: In his argument, the lawyer presented compelling case material, including witness testimonies and financial records, to prove his client's innocence.
